Getting your Jinka JK-1351 cutting plotter to communicate with your computer is the most important step in your production workflow. Without the correct driver software, your hardware is essentially a very expensive paperweight.
This guide covers everything you need to know about finding, installing, and troubleshooting the Jinka JK-1351 driver software to get you back to cutting vinyl. Understanding the Jinka JK-1351 Connection
The Jinka JK-1351 typically uses a USB-to-Serial connection. This means that even though you are plugging a USB cable into your laptop, your computer sees it as a COM port (Serial port). To make this work, you need a specific bridge driver—most commonly the CH340 or FTDI chipset driver. 📍 Key Software Components USB Driver: Links the hardware to Windows.
Cutting Software: Programs like ArtCut, SignMaster, or Flexi.
Plotter Controller: Manages the specific "language" (usually DMPL or HPGL) the machine speaks. How to Install the Jinka JK-1351 Driver Outdated drivers lead to printing lags and crashes
Follow these steps to ensure a clean installation on Windows 10 or 11. 1. Download the Correct Driver Most Jinka machines utilize the CH340 USB Serial Driver.
Visit the official Jinka website or your software provider's portal (like SignMaster).
Download the .zip or .exe file compatible with your OS (64-bit is standard for modern PCs). 2. Physical Connection Plug the JK-1351 into a USB port on your PC. Turn the machine on.
Wait for Windows to attempt a "Plug and Play" discovery (it will likely fail, which is why we need the manual driver). 3. Run the Installer Open the downloaded driver file. Click Install.
A "Driver install success" message should appear within seconds. Configuring the COM Port
Once the driver is installed, you must tell your cutting software exactly where to look for the machine. Open Device Manager on your PC. Expand the Ports (COM & LPT) section. Look for USB-SERIAL CH340 (COMX)—the "X" is a number. Note that number (e.g., COM3).
In your cutting software (SignMaster/ArtCut), go to Connection Settings and match the COM port to the one found in Device Manager. Common Troubleshooting Issues ❌ Machine Not Responding
Check the Baud Rate: Most Jinka plotters require a Baud Rate of 9600 or 38400.
Try a different USB port: Avoid using USB hubs; plug directly into the motherboard. ❌ Driver Signature Error
On Windows 10/11, you may need to "Disable Driver Signature Enforcement" in the recovery settings to allow the Jinka driver to install properly. ❌ "Device Not Recognized"
This usually indicates a faulty USB cable. Jinka machines are sensitive to interference; try a shielded USB cable under 2 meters in length. Best Software for Jinka JK-1351 Use the search bar or browse by model number
